Its quite frustrating to actually work your ass off all weekend and not really see any tangible progress on the house. Its all the behind the scenes stuff that isn't fun but is totally necessary.

Hubby pruned all of the neighbours trees which I have to admit turned out to be a big job. I on the other hand spent the day sealing the garage concrete floor. Its one of those jobs that doesn't seem to have much value on the face of it. It looks the same afterward (except slightly darker) and it doesn't really "do" anything for me but its totally worth it in the long run .... or at least that's what I have been told.

Sealing the floor will be a benefit in two ways. Firstly it will actually seal in the dust so we will never have to worry about tramping white powder over my lovely dark wood floors. Secondly it will actually protect it from future staining. Ok so I get it its great, but I just want to start doing "forward" stuff. So things are going well and we have to say the builder has been awesome but there is always going to be some things that are just .... crap.

Hubby found one on Monday. We have a small planter box build into the house. What we didn't realise until the "rains came" is that they put it under the main slab with no real way for the water to escape .... oh yes but it does get better. They also made sure that one of the downpipes that drains the main front roof falls into this watertight flowerbed!

Photobucket 

Photobucket 

In order to actually make it work we had to put a step up onto the pathway from the driveway .... Surprisingly adding yet another level makes it all very interesting so I'm happy but the extra work hubby had to do for a really simple task .... stupid!

Photobucket


2 days of grinding the slab and cutting through the concrete means we now finally have the drain running into the soak well.

Photobucket

You may ask ... why would this not have been picked up in all the detailed design drawings but downpipes will be at plumbers discretion.
